Magali SIMARD GALDÈS
Soprano



Alexandre Pham, Classiquenews Benjamin, Written on Skin – Lille, janvier 2024
Quebec soprano Magali Simard-Galdès stands out for her brilliant, crystalline voice, which she knows how to adorn with heady colours depending on the score. Her vocal mastery and natural musicality allow her to magnify a very wide repertoire ranging from Baroque music, which she particularly loves, to contemporary music, for which she possesses all the precision required.
On the opera stage, Magali commands a celebrated presence and theatrical ease. Her ability to blend into each character allows her to tackle with great success roles as diverse as those of Agnès (Benjamin, Written on Skin), Musetta (Puccini, La Bohème), Micaëla (Bizet, Carmen), Tytania (Britten, A Midsummer Night's Dream), Gilda (Verdi, Rigoletto), Roxane (DiChiera, Cyrano de Bergerac), Constance (Poulenc, Dialogues des Carmélites) and Nicette (Hérold, Le pré aux clercs).
She has performed these roles at the Vancouver and Montreal Operas, Opera Carolina, Toledo Opera, Tapestry Opera and Wexford Festival Opera, as well as at the Cologne Opera, Opéra du Rhin and Auditorium du Nouveau Siècle in Lille.
In concert, she impresses with the same charisma, which has led her to be invited in recent years to perform with specialist ensembles such as Le Concert Spirituel, Le Cercle de l'Harmonie, Les Violons du Roy, Arion Baroque Orchestra and Ensemble Caprice.
With her considerable projection, she also performs regularly with symphony orchestras such as the Orchestre National de Lille, the Orchestre de chambre de Genève, the Orchestre Classique de Montréal, the National Arts Centre Orchestra in Ottawa, the Houston Symphony, the Orchestre symphonique de Québec, the Orchestre Métropolitain and the Orchestre du Festival Classica in Quebec, under the baton of Yannick Nézet-Séguin, Jacques Lacombe, Jean-Marie Zeitouni, Bernard Labadie, Hervé Niquet, Jean-François Rivest, Mathieu Lussier, François-Xavier Roth, Jérémie Rhorer and Alexandre Bloch.
Her recent engagements include Handel's The Messiah and Israel in Egypt with Hervé Niquet and Le Concert Spirituel, Boulez's Pli selon Pli with Jonathan Nott and the WDR Sinfonieorchester Köln, the role of Sophie in Massenet's Werther with Marc Leroy-Calatayud and the Geneva Chamber Orchestra (alongside Pene Patti) and Léonore in Grétry's L'Amant Jaloux with Arion Baroque Orchestra.
The 2025/2026 season will feature important roles such as Micaëla in Carmen at the Opéra de Montréal (Orchestre métropolitain conducted by Jean-Marie Zeitouni and directed by Anna Theodosakis), as well as tours (including Mozart's Requiem with Les Violons du Roy conducted by Bernard Labadie).
Since autumn 2022, Magali, a committed woman, has also been making her voice heard as an environmental columnist on ICI première. She holds a master's degree in management and sustainable development from HEC Montréal.
